Transaction 2228c59aed25087a3badfe29942304b3ea52e296cbf089856f39a966e6c3c319

1 Input
2 Outputs
  • 2228c59aed25087a3badfe29942304b3ea52e296cbf089856f39a966e6c3c319:0
  • value  1059000
    address  31ktib6bEJsD6ZKp9knEUo7EUwbewwuAFG
  • 2228c59aed25087a3badfe29942304b3ea52e296cbf089856f39a966e6c3c319:1
  • value  5328756
    address  121Xd1gppd6FJqvKKAJv596CfCv8dJhCoR